BLUF: A prominent distilling company has acquired an expansive estate previously owned by Dylan and David Zimmerman, complete with various facilities and an abundance of natural beauty.

OSINT: A company known for its ownership of the distinguished Tomintoul and Glencadam Distilleries, expended a considerable £4,257,650 to buy a remarkable estate. The estate was previously owned by Dylan (82) and his brother David Zimmerman, who procured it for a considerably lower price of £2.2m. The property is no ordinary residence. It boasts multiple reception rooms, including a specialised music room, 11 bathrooms, as well as seven additional bedrooms in the attic. Enveloping the house is a sprawling 25 acres of land. This not only includes charming cottages but also a large greenhouse, a neatly maintained walled garden, architectural embellishments known as follies, an elaborate fountain, and a designated area for playing croquet.
